Guided Design Course

The Ceros Guided Design Course will explore designing in and for Ceros through a series of discussions and workshops. This 4-week course will be held starting June 8th, at 12:00 pm - and will continue each Wednesday for 4 weeks. The course will consist of guided instructional sessions and build-along activities to take your Ceros production to the next level. Come prepared to interact, ask questions and learn from our highly talented designers.

TIME: Wednesdays at 12:00PM - 1:00PM EST (1 hour sessions)

SESSIONS: 4 scheduled sessions

June 8 Introduction: We will revisit the studio from a ‘new user’ perspective, to chat through any of the uncommon tools as well as newer features or methods that can improve overall workflow.

June 15 Design Principles: How to design for digital content with Ceros in mind. We will also dive into the studio to review the import and masking features.

June 22 Build-Along: Instructors will guide everyone through the steps of creating a series of interactions to create popups, tab components, and carousels.

June 29 Build-Along: Instructors will guide everyone through steps of building out the following data visualizations: pie chart, timeline, and bar graph.
